BR Class 55 'Detlic' no.55022 'Royal Scots Grey' hauled the Birmingham International - Penzance - Birmingham International tour 'The Mazey Day Cornishman' (1Z55/1Z56). She is seen on the return leg of the tour absolutely flying through Taunton Station, horns a blowing. She had left Plymouth 40 minutes late but by the time she got to us she was only 16 minutes down, which is quite impressive. Yep 95. Me and two colleagues were timing together. Three GPS's all with good signal and a watch all agreed. We were expecting 100mph but were having coolant issues on No 2 power unit- we'd come part way from PZ on one engine. The outward run had been wonderful, cruising for a while at 100 on the level then passing Taunton (uphill this time!) at 95mph. We'd cleared Whiteball at 68 and kept full power on to near Cullompton which had given us a max of 103mph. 515 ton train and one amazing loco.
